Each stack is useful; the difference is the frontend and backend ecosystem.
MERN uses React; MEAN uses Angular.
MERN uses JavaScript/TypeScript; Java full stack centres Java and Spring.
MERN uses Node.js; Python full stack uses Python backend frameworks.

Understand how browsers, servers, APIs and databases work together.
Build accessible, semantic page structures.
Create responsive interfaces for mobile and desktop.
Write reliable client-side logic using modern JavaScript.
Build interactive browser experiences and consume APIs.
Add useful type safety to frontend and backend code.
Build component-based user interfaces with React.
Organise multi-page React applications.
Manage real interface state, forms and user feedback.
Build server-side JavaScript programs with Node.js.
Design REST APIs for frontend applications.
Store and query document data using MongoDB.
Create maintainable application data models.
Protect user accounts, routes and application data.
Connect React, Express and MongoDB into complete features.
Develop, review and troubleshoot like a team.
Prepare a MERN application for a production environment.
Plan, build, secure, test, deploy and explain a complete MERN application.
